C.A.S.E is seeking an experienced, insightful strategic operational leader to oversee the organizations’ client-serving program operations. The DPO contributes to the successful achievement of C.A.S.E’s mission and strategic initiatives by providing leadership that ensures the delivery of competent quality services, driving continuous quality improvement, best practice, operational/organizational efficiencies and strategic growth.  Reporting to the CEO, the DPO is responsible for growing service markets, optimizing and integrating sustainable program operations, leading operational refinement, coach and develop a talented team to ensure we have the resources to deliver the specialized services our reputation is built upon.

Improving the lives of children who have been adopted or in foster care and their families through counseling, lifelong education, and a growing national network of trained professionals.

The Center for Adoption Support and Education (C.A.S.E.) is celebrating 22 years as a premier mental health organization providing highly specialized services for children, teens and their families. C.A.S.E has developed a national reputation for excellence in meeting the needs of the foster care and adoption community by providing adoption competent mental health services, case management, educational resources that significantly impacts the lives, stability and permanency of adoptive families. C.A.S.E. is privileged to be able to nurture, inspire and empower anyone whose life is touched by foster care and adoption. With five offices across the Washington, D.C metro area, we are the leading regional provider of pre-and-post adoption support serving more than 7,000 clinical clients to date.
